COMPOSITION ALIMENTAIRE COMPRENANT AU MOINS UNE VITAMINE NATURELLE, SUSCEPTIBLE DE SUBIR UN TRAITEMENT THERMIQUE La présente invention concerne une composition alimentaire telle que des céréales, notamment pour nourrissons, plus particulièrement d'origine biologique et qui comprend au moins une vitamine naturelle tout en étant susceptible de subir un traitement thermique tel qu'une cuisson sans que la ou lesdites vitamines soient dégradées. The present invention relates to a food composition such as cereals, in particular for infants, more particularly of biological origin and which comprises at least one natural vitamin while being capable of undergo a heat treatment such as cooking without the said vitamin or vitamins being degraded.
On sait que la plupart des produits obtenus par la voie industrielle et destinés notamment à l'alimentation pour nourrissons doivent être garantis réglementairement en vitamines c'est-à-dire qu'ils sont restaurés en vitamines ne se trouvant plus en quantité suffisante dans ledit produit industriel. Ceci permet par exemple de couvrir les besoins du nourrisson en vitamine C. It is known that most of the products obtained by the industrial route and intended in particular for baby food must be legally guaranteed in vitamins, that is to say that they are restored in vitamins no longer found in sufficient quantity in said industrial product. This allows, for example, to cover the infant's vitamin C needs.
C'est ainsi que les jus de fruits sont complétés en vitamine C de synthèse, car la vitamine C naturelle contenue dans les fruits servant à la fabrication de ces jus est dégradée. En effet, le taux de vitamine C naturelle diminue, d'une part, naturellement après la cueillette au cours du temps de conservation des fruits en attente de leur traitement et, d'autre part, du fait des étapes du procédé industriel d'obtention et de traitement pour leur conservation des jus. This is how fruit juices are supplemented with synthetic vitamin C, because the natural vitamin C contained in the fruits used to make these juices is degraded. Indeed, the level of natural vitamin C decreases, on the one hand, naturally after picking during the time of conservation of the fruits awaiting their treatment and, on the other hand, due to the stages of the industrial process of obtaining and treatment for their conservation of juices.
Dans le cas des céréales par exemple, il est prévu de restaurer les compositions en vitamine 131, ceci de façon réglementaire et avec d'autres vitamines éventuellement mais ceci sans obligation. Parallèlement aux produits fabriqués industriellement à partir de produits de culture intensive, il existe des produits dits biologiques ou "bio" qui répondent à certains critères de production et qui sont issus de l'agriculture biologique. Parmi ces critères, on note l'utilisation de produits de traitement des cultures qui ne font appel ni aux pesticides de synthèse ni aux engrais chimiques. In the case of cereals, for example, it is planned to restore the vitamin 131 compositions, this in a regulatory manner and with other vitamins possibly but this without obligation. In addition to products produced industrially from intensive cultivation products, there are so-called organic or "organic" products which meet certain production criteria and which come from organic farming. Among these criteria, we note the use of crop treatment products that use neither synthetic pesticides nor chemical fertilizers.
De ce fait, pour que certaines céréales par exemple puissent être considérées et vendues avec la mention 'bio", il est interdit de supplémenter lesdites céréales avec des vitamines de synthèse sauf si ces vitamines sont imposées telles que la vitamine B1 dans les céréales et la vitamine C dans les jus. Therefore, so that certain cereals for example can be considered and sold with the mention "organic", it is prohibited to supplement said cereals with synthetic vitamins unless these vitamins are imposed such as vitamin B1 in cereals and vitamin C in juices.
Par ailleurs, on sait que la chaleur dégrade les vitamines de synthèse qui sont parfaitement pures. Ceci est particulièrement regrettable dans le cas des céréales qui subissent un traitement thermique de cuisson avant une atomisation et granulation pour la mise en poudre ou un séchage sur rouleau. Cette dégradation peut se situer à des niveaux de pertes de près de 30%. Furthermore, we know that heat degrades synthetic vitamins which are perfectly pure. This is particularly regrettable in the case of cereals which undergo a heat treatment of cooking before an atomization and granulation for the setting in powder or a drying on roller. This deterioration can be at loss levels of almost 30%.
Pour pallier cette dégradation en cours du process industriel, la solution actuellement retenue est le surdosage en vitamines d'origine de synthèse en sorte de maintenir au final dans le produit une quantité suffisante de vitamines intègres. To overcome this deterioration during the industrial process, the solution currently adopted is the overdose of vitamins of synthetic origin so as to ultimately maintain in the product a sufficient amount of intact vitamins.
D'une part, une telle pratique implique des pertes de vitamines par une dégradation prématurée et de plus, le dosage final est délicat à obtenir de façon satisfaisante et pour le moins complique le contrôle en cours de fabrication. On the one hand, such a practice involves loss of vitamins by premature degradation and, moreover, the final dosage is difficult to obtain in a satisfactory manner and at the very least complicates the control during manufacture.
La présente invention concerne une composition naturelle notamment biologique, comprenant au moins une vitamine naturelle, notamment de la thiamine synonyme aussi de vitamine B1 qui réduit les surdosages, les pertes en fabrication, qui autorise la cuisson et la mise en oeuvre des procédés de mise en poudre pour la fabrication de produits instantanés. The present invention relates to a natural composition, in particular a biological composition, comprising at least one natural vitamin, in particular thiamine also synonymous with vitamin B1 which reduces overdoses, manufacturing losses, which allows cooking and the implementation of methods of implementation. powder for making instant products.
A cet effet, la présente invention est maintenant décrite en détail. To this end, the present invention is now described in detail.
La composition alimentaire notamment d'origine biologique comprend un produit de base notamment biologique tel que des céréales d'origine biologique. Ces céréales sont donc issues de grains de plants cultivés suivant les règles de l'agriculture biologique. The food composition, in particular of biological origin, comprises a basic product, in particular organic, such as cereals of organic origin. These cereals therefore come from seeds of plants cultivated according to the rules of organic farming.
On associe alors aux céréales ainsi obtenues au moins une vitamine d'origine naturelle et plus particulièrement de la thiamine. Cette thiamine est obtenue de façon naturelle par exemple à partir de levure de bière ou de sons de céréales. We then associate with the cereals thus obtained at least one vitamin of natural origin and more particularly thiamine. This thiamine is obtained naturally, for example from brewer's yeast or cereal bran.
Une telle thiamine est encapsulée naturellement dans une gangue de protéines de type liguant, contrairement à la thiamine d'origine synthétique qui est dépourvue d'une telle protection. Such a thiamine is naturally encapsulated in a gangue of ligating type proteins, unlike thiamine of synthetic origin which is devoid of such protection.
Ainsi, dans le Journal Nutritional Vitaminol (Tokyo) 1998 Oct; 44(5):665-72, on décrit une thiamine obtenue à partir de graines de tournesol. Les protéines isolées sont composées en majorité, de glutamine ou d'acide glutamique et d'asparagine ou d'acide aspartique. Thus, in the Nutritional Vitaminol Journal (Tokyo) 1998 Oct; 44 (5): 665-72, a thiamine obtained from sunflower seeds is described. The isolated proteins are mainly composed of glutamine or glutamic acid and asparagine or aspartic acid.
Dans d'autres cas, comme le blé noir, les protéines sont des polypeptides liés par des liaisons bisulfures. In other cases, like buckwheat, proteins are polypeptides linked by disulfide bonds.
Ces protéines en fonction des céréales de départ permettent de disposer d'une thiamine fortement résistante aux traitements thermiques utilisant des températures telles que des températures de cuisson de l'agro-alimentaire c'est-à-dire de l'ordre d'une centaine de degrés Celsius. These proteins, depending on the starting cereals, make it possible to have a thiamine which is highly resistant to heat treatments using temperatures such as cooking temperatures for the food industry, that is to say of the order of one hundred. degrees Celsius.
II convient d'associer ce type de thiamine aux céréales obtenues, notamment par la voie de l'agriculture biologique et de réaliser la composition adaptée en vue d'obtenir le produit fini recherché. It is advisable to associate this type of thiamine with the cereals obtained, in particular by the way of organic farming and to produce the suitable composition in order to obtain the desired finished product.
Cette composition est cuite en phase liquide avec une soumission à un traitement thermique permettant la cuisson de certains ingrédients qui le nécessitent pour une bonne digestibilité et faisant ressortir les qualités organoleptiques recherchées, notamment du point de vue de la texture. This composition is cooked in the liquid phase with a submission to a heat treatment allowing the cooking of certain ingredients which require it for good digestibility and bringing out the desired organoleptic qualities, in particular from the point of view of the texture.
Cette composition liquide est ensuite déshydratée pour une facilité de conservation, de transport et d'utilisation. Une telle opération est généralement réalisée dans une tour d'atomisation avec une opération simultanée ou complémentaire de granulation ou préférentiellement sur des tambours séchants suivant la consistance et le type de produit. This liquid composition is then dehydrated for ease of storage, transport and use. Such an operation is generally carried out in an atomization tower with a simultaneous or complementary operation of granulation or preferably on drying drums depending on the consistency and the type of product.
La composition déshydratée ainsi obtenue est prête à la consommation. Comme la thiamine ajoutée reste intègre durant la cuisson, la teneur en vitamine B1 initialement ajoutée reste constante, ce qui évite la nécessité de surdoser initialement. The dehydrated composition thus obtained is ready for consumption. As the added thiamine remains intact during cooking, the vitamin B1 content initially added remains constant, which avoids the need to initially overdose.
De plus, l'appellation "bio" peut être conservée puisque l'apport en vitamine est d'origine naturelle et biologique, quand bien même une telle vitamine n'est pas obligatoire réglementairement . In addition, the name "organic" can be kept since the vitamin intake is of natural and organic origin, even if such a vitamin is not mandatory by law.
On peut ainsi disposer d'une composition alimentaire en l'occurrence de céréales pour nourrissons qui contiennent les apports nécessaires en au moins une vitamine au nourrisson qui l'absorbe. Comme la vitamine B1 joue un rôle essentiel dans la transformation de l'acide pyruvique en acide acétique lors de la transformation des glucides en lipides, on comprend que l'apport en vitamine B1 est important. On sait aussi que la vitamine B1 intervient dans les bilans énergétiques à partir des glucides. It is thus possible to have a food composition, in this case infant cereals which contain the necessary intakes of at least one vitamin for the infant who absorbs it. As vitamin B1 plays an essential role in the transformation of pyruvic acid into acetic acid during the transformation of carbohydrates into lipids, we understand that the intake of vitamin B1 is important. We also know that vitamin B1 is involved in energy balances from carbohydrates.
Le fait de recourir à une vitamine B1 protégée par des protéines de type liguant, permet de satisfaire et de respecter les dates limites d'utilisations optimales (DLUO). The fact of using a vitamin B1 protected by ligating type proteins, makes it possible to satisfy and respect the expiry dates for optimal uses (BBD).
Une composition particulière est donnée à titre d'exemple - 50% de céréales de riz, - 45 à 47% de céréales de maïs, - 3 à 5 % de cacao en poudre dégraissé, et - 0,2 à 0,7, plus particulièrement 0,5 mg de vitamine B1 naturelle pour 100 g de produit sec. A particular composition is given by way of example - 50% of rice cereals, - 45 to 47% of corn cereals, - 3 to 5% of defatted cocoa powder, and - 0.2 to 0.7, more particularly 0.5 mg of natural vitamin B1 per 100 g of dry product.
La présentation de cette composition est avantageusement sous forme de flocons et conditionnée sous atmosphère protectrice. The presentation of this composition is advantageously in the form of flakes and packaged in a protective atmosphere.
La description qui vient d'être faite est indiquée pour les céréales pour nourrissons mais l'adjonction d'au moins une vitamine d'origine naturelle peut être effectuée dans un lait infantile. The description which has just been given is indicated for cereals for infants, but the addition of at least one vitamin of natural origin can be carried out in infant milk.
II est à noter que l'encapsulation naturelle de la vitamine retenue évite d'effectuer une telle opération au moyen de produits de synthèse éventuellement non compatible avec le "bio" tels que des huiles végétales hydrogénées ou des amidons modifiés. En outre, un autre avantage de disposer d'une vitamine d'origine naturelle qui résiste à la température, c'est que les éventuelles charges microbiologiques ou biologiques sont dégradées durant les phases de traitement thermique. It should be noted that the natural encapsulation of the retained vitamin avoids carrying out such an operation by means of synthetic products possibly not compatible with "bio" such as hydrogenated vegetable oils or modified starches. In addition, another advantage of having a vitamin of natural origin which is resistant to temperature is that any microbiological or biological charges are degraded during the heat treatment phases.
Dans les exemples donnés et de façon générale, la ou les vitamines retenues sont introduites avec les céréales ou le lait avant la cuisson ou le traitement thermique mais il est aussi possible de prévoir une introduction après traitement thermique.In the examples given and in general, the retained vitamin or vitamins are introduced with the cereals or the milk before cooking or the heat treatment but it is also possible to provide for an introduction after heat treatment.
